Bette Midler has regrets about her short-lived sitcom, which she called a "big, big mistake."
The actress and singer said she wishes she had sued after a young Lindsay Lohan pulled out of the "Hocus Pocus" star’s eponymous comedy "Bette" following the pilot episode 24 years ago.
"I believe it would have worked if I had had a team that was on my side," Midler told David Duchovny on his "Fail Better" podcast of her 2000 to 2001 CBS show in which she played a version of herself.
